Thyroid Hormone

Thyroid hormone is a hormone produced by the thyroid gland, a gland that has a butterfly-like shape. The location of the thyroid gland is in the middle of the front of the neck.

Thyroid hormone is very important because it plays a role in metabolic processes and affects every cell and tissue in the body. If production is excessive or insufficient, it can trigger various health problems, from mild to severe.

Thyroid hormones produced by the body are divided into two; thyroxine hormone (T4) and triiodothyronine hormone (T3).

  • Thyroxine hormone (T4)  is a type of hormone produced by the body after the thyroid gland receives iodine intake.
  • The hormone triiodothyronine (T3) is the second hormone after thyroxine produced by the thyroid gland. This hormone, commonly known as the T3 hormone, is an active form of thyroid hormone which functions to regulate many important things in the body.

Thyroid Hormone Function:
Some important functions of thyroid hormone that you must know are:

  • Controls muscle movement and contraction
  • Regulates brain function
  • Plays a role in body development
  • Regulates heart function and digestive system
  • Maintains the speed of metabolic or digestive processes in the body
  • Maintain bone health
  • Regulates the number of calories that  the body must burn so that it influences the rise and fall of body weight
  • Regulates body temperature
  • Regulates cell turnover in the body


Thyroid Hormone Problems
Health problems related to thyroid hormone are generally divided into two, namely conditions when thyroid hormone is excessive and deficient.


Excess thyroid hormone
The condition of hyperthyroidism occurs when the thyroid gland is too active in producing hormones which causes thyroid hormone levels to become too high.
This condition causes the body's metabolism to run faster and causes several symptoms, such as:

  • Weight loss
  • Shaking or tremors
  • Hair loss
  • Nervousness or restlessness
  • Difficulty concentrating
  • The body produces excessive sweat
  • Sensitive or unable to tolerate hot temperatures
  • Hard to sleep
  • Tired easily
  • Heart rate becomes faster


Thyroid Hormone Deficiency
Hypothyroidism occurs when the thyroid gland cannot produce sufficient amounts of thyroid hormone. Some symptoms of hypothyroidism include :

  • The body's metabolism becomes slow
  • Easy to gain weight
  • Tired easily
  • Memory impairment
  • Bowel obstruction
  • Not resistant to cold air
  • Heart rate slows
  • Dry skin
  • Hoarseness
  • Hair is dry and breaks easily
